This report details the Makeable App database development project, focusing on a literature review of relevant research papers and design considerations for a mobile application. The project aims to create a database for an application designed to help individuals with disabilities find technology solutions. The report explores the use of Node.js for backend database, mobile app development, and cross-platform frameworks like Flutter. The literature review covers topics such as server-side scripting languages, mobile application accessibility, and the advantages of cross-platform development. The report also discusses the importance of usability and design principles for applications catering to users with disabilities, and the functional and non-functional requirements. The project's scope, methodology, and feasibility are also outlined, providing a comprehensive overview of the Makeable App database development.
